Band 7+: The graph below presents the employment patterns in the USA between 1930 and 2010. Summarise the information by selecting and report in the main features, and make comparisons where relevant.

The image shows line graphs comparing USA labor force employment from 1930 to 2010 in five sectors: Industrial, Technical, Sales and Office, Other Services, and Farming, Fishing and Forestry. Industrial employment decreased from 70% to below 20%, Technical increased from below 20% to above 40%, Sales and Office increased from 10% to above 25%, Other Services increased from below 10% to above 25%, and Farming, Fishing and Forestry decreased from above 40% to below 5%.
